EXCLUSIVE: Young Sherlock producer Motive Pictures is developing two new projects with Booker Prize-winning author Marlon James, while bolstering its development team to manage a growing slate of dramas.

Motive previously collaborated with James on his first TV project, Get Millie Black, for Channel 4 in the UK and HBO in the U.S. Now James, who won the Booker Prize for ‘A Brief History of Seven Killings’, has a brace of new projects with Motive. We hear one is called Marauders and is being billed as a blood-soaked odyssey into the lawless Caribbean, set during the Golden Age of piracy. The project is in development with an as-yet-unnamed broadcaster. The second work in progress is The School, a revenge epic and geopolitical thriller that plays out across the Americas.
